How Alabama law applies in Grant

This table holds the Alabama rate and licensing rules for consumer loans made to Grant's 1,057 residents.

RuleDetailSource
State lending regulatorAlabama State Banking Department — Bureau of Loans (BOL)
Source says: "The Bureau of Loans (hereinafter “the BOL”) was established in 1945". The BOL administers the Small Loan Act, Consumer Credit Act, Pawn Shop Act, Mortgage Brokers Licensing Act, Deferred Presentment Services Act and SAFE Act.

Parity lending rate provision (§ 8-8-1.1)Any lender may charge the same rates as any federally or state-chartered or licensed lending institution in Alabama
Source says: "may, on any loans or extensions of credit made by them, charge or impose the same rate of interest or finance charge".

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)6% per annum without a written contract; 8% per annum by written contract
Source says: "except by written contract is $6 upon $100 for one year"; "the rate of interest by written contract is not to exceed $8 upon $100 for one year". (Code text retrieved from the Alabama Legislature's official Code of Alabama service.)

What a Grant borrower is actually offered

With roughly 1,057 residents, Grant is a small community; its personal loans are typically unsecured, priced from your credit rather than the city's size. Two numbers drive a Grant loan: the APR, which includes fees, and the term, which decides how long you keep paying. A longer term lowers the monthly payment on a Grant loan but raises total interest, so the smallest payment is not the cheapest loan.

Common questions

What are my options in Grant if my credit is poor?
Borrowing is still possible, but expect a higher APR and a smaller approved amount. Lenders that accept lower scores hold statewide licences, so what is open to you in Grant is the same as anywhere in Alabama.
What loan size can I expect in Grant?
Most personal loans sit somewhere between $1,000 and $50,000, though the figure you are approved for turns on the lender, your income and your credit. Model the monthly payment first with our personal loan calculator.
Do I have to pledge anything to borrow in Grant?
For an unsecured personal loan, no — there is nothing to pledge. A secured loan, such as home equity or one secured by a vehicle, does require collateral, and default puts that asset at risk.
Does comparing loans in Grant cost me credit score points?
Not during pre-qualification, which normally uses a soft pull and leaves your score alone. Submitting a full application triggers a hard inquiry, which can trim a few points briefly.
